Zone 37 is a zone of the municipality of Ad Dawhah in the state of Qatar. The main districts recorded in the 2015 population census were Fereej Bin Omran, New Al Hitmi, and Hamad Medical City.[2]

Demographics[edit]

Year Population
1986[3] 11,873
1997[4] 12,502
2004[5] 13,189
2010[6] 21,066
2015[2] 26,121
